SMP (aka Sounds of Mass Production) has released “Pissing on the Legacy,” a
digital-only remix album. The album-- which contains remixes by Albatrosse,
Bloodwire, Digital Geist, Databind, Diskonnekted, Hardwire, Penal Colony,
Spinefolder, and Stochastic Theory -- is available for purchase now at

“Pissing on the Legacy,” which is SMP’s second remix album (the first
being the 2001 release, “Hacked”) will be available through all legitimate
digital download sites in the near future.
“Pissing on the Legacy” is comprised of remixed versions of most of the
tracks from SMP’s fifth studio album, “The Treatment.” It is graced by
the musicianship of Wade Alin of Christ Analogue, Mike Welch of Slave Unit,
Chris Roy of Doll Factory, and Dee Madden of Penal Colony.
SMP is still on hiatus, having performed its last concert more than six months
ago in Seattle, WA., at the El Corazon. There are no plans for future releases.
